Insert Menu

You will find commands for inserting strings and variables in the Insert Menu. This Menu is only available for some of the resources such as the "String Table", the "Variable List" window and the "Basic Script" window.

 

 

New String (Ins)

This command inserts a new string in the table. The string's ID is inserted with a progressive number with the following syntax: "String00001".

 

New Language Column... (ALT+Ins)

This command inserts a new column representing a new language. When this command is executed, an input box opens to insert the column's name (normally the name of the language in question).

 

New Variable...

Inserts a new variable in the Real Time DB.

 

New Variable Group

Inserts a new Variable group within the Real Time DB.

 

New Structure Definition

Inserts a new Structure Prototype in the Real Time DB.

 

New Communication Driver

Inserts a new Communication Driver in the Real Time DB.

 

Add System Variables

Inserts the Structure Prototype of the relative  "_SysVar_" variable within the Real Time DB.
